Michael Roth | Prep Hoops Scout
One of the biggest stock risers from the Prep Hoops Expo in the fall, McGuinea is one of the most talented vertical athletes in Ohio’s 2027 class. McGuinea was flying across the court with multiple jaw dropping dunks and blocked shots. Improving as a ball handler and perimeter shooter, McGuinea is going to have the opportunity to play with the ball in his hands for a Bedford team that sits at 2-1 with their lone loss to Saint Ignatius. Expect to hear a lot about McGuinea and Bedford this winter around northeast Ohio.

One of the more athletic wings in the state, McGuinea can fly in the air and throw down powerful dunks with impressive explosiveness. A rare two foot leaper at his height, McGuinea is comfortable rising up even with rim protectors around the area. A strong athlete who doesn’t get pushed off his spots as a slasher, McGuinea is tough when he’s able to turn the corner with the ball in his left hand. Showing development as a shooter as well, McGuinea is a prime candidate to be a breakout player in northeast Ohio next season.

McGuinea showed great slashing ability. He has great acrobatic finishes, with contact, and with either hand. He gets downhill quick and puts the ball in the rim. He has a good build with a nice length and is sneaky strong. He attacks the rim with such aggressive intent that players stop wanting to get in front of him as the game goes on. He can step out and hit an open shot when left open. Really solid defender as well that is great perimeter quickness and applies good pressure.

A lengthy guard with very impressive size at the 15U level, McGuinea was simply on another level athletically. The lefty uses long strides when attacking the rim, converting on several euro steps. McGuinea also broke a few double teams handling the basketball, which speaks to his skill-set as a 6’3″ guard. Displayed some quick twitch as a help-side defender. Again, he was on another level.
